1. Choose Warm and Soft Colors
Colors greatly impact the atmosphere of a room. To create a cozy vibe, opt for warm tones like soft beiges, creamy whites, warm grays, or gentle shades of gold and peach. These colors help soften the space and make it feel inviting.
Tips for choosing colors:
– Use warm-toned paint or wallpaper for walls.
– Incorporate throw pillows and blankets with warm colors.
– Balance warm hues with neutral colors to avoid overwhelming the room.
2. Layer Textures for Added Comfort
Texture plays a big role in making a home feel cozy. Mixing different textures like soft fabrics, natural fibers, and smooth surfaces can add depth and visual interest.
How to layer textures:
– Use plush throw blankets and soft cushions on sofas and chairs.
– Add rugs made from wool, cotton, or jute to the floor.
– Incorporate natural elements like wooden furniture or wicker baskets.
3. Use Soft, Ambient Lighting
Lighting sets the mood instantly. Harsh, bright lights can make a space feel cold and clinical. Instead, choose soft, warm lighting options that create a relaxed atmosphere.
Lighting ideas:
– Place lamps with warm-toned bulbs around the room.
– Use string lights or fairy lights for a gentle glow.
– Add candles for a flickering, soothing light (always ensure safety).
4. Bring Nature Indoors
Plants and natural elements add freshness and warmth to any room. They create a connection to the outdoors and improve air quality.
Ways to incorporate nature:
– Display potted plants or small indoor trees.
– Use natural materials like wood, stone, or clay in furniture and décor.
– Bring in fresh flowers or dried botanicals for seasonal charm.
5. Keep Your Space Organized and Clutter-Free
A cluttered space can feel stressful rather than cozy. Keeping your home tidy and organized helps create a calm, welcoming environment.
Organization tips:
– Use baskets or bins to store items neatly.
– Regularly declutter rooms and donate or discard unused things.
– Create designated spaces for keys, mail, and everyday essentials.
6. Personalize Your Space
Your home should reflect who you are and what you love. Adding personal touches makes a space feel truly inviting to both you and your guests.
How to personalize:
– Display photos of family, friends, or favorite places.
– Showcase meaningful souvenirs, artwork, or handmade crafts.
– Incorporate your favorite colors and patterns in decor items.
7. Invest in Comfortable Furniture
Comfort is key to a cozy home. Choose furniture that encourages relaxation and makes you want to linger.
Furniture suggestions:
– Opt for sofas and chairs with soft cushions and supportive backs.
– Use upholstered furniture or add cushions to harder seating.
– Consider adding a reading nook or a cozy corner with a comfortable chair and good lighting.
8. Incorporate Pleasant Scents
Scent greatly influences how cozy and inviting your home feels. Pleasant aromas can relax your mind and make visitors feel welcome.
Scent ideas:
– Use scented candles or essential oil diffusers with aromas like lavender, vanilla, or cinnamon.
– Simmer natural spices like cloves or citrus peels on the stove.
– Fresh flowers can also provide a natural and subtle fragrance.
9. Create Multi-Functional Spaces
A cozy home is also one that suits your lifestyle. Multi-functional spaces can help you maximize comfort in any room.
Examples of multi-functional areas:
– A dining table that doubles as a workspace.
– A living room corner with a small desk for hobbies or work.
– Using ottomans or benches for extra seating and storage.
10. Add Cozy Window Treatments
Windows are focal points and influence how a room feels. Soft curtains or blinds can create privacy and soften harsh light, contributing to a cozy atmosphere.
Window treatment tips:
– Use thick, heavy curtains in cold months and light, sheer fabrics in warm months.
– Coordinate colors and textures with your overall décor.
– Consider layered treatments—blinds combined with curtains—for both function and style.
